13,984. Taaffe, H. E. June 8. Sealing bottles &c.- Relates to means for sealing bottles or other vessels to prevent tampering with their contents. The seal consists of two bent glass strips a, b, the shorter legs of which fit round the neck below the rim, the longer legs being adapted to meet and form a level joint between their bevelled ends e. When fitted to the neck, the parts are cemented together, and the vessel cannot then be opened without breaking the seal. A metal disc g is inserted in the cork to facilitate breaking the seal.
